The Beauty of Sunset

I remember where I took this photo. This was the parking lot of Jimmy Buffet, it was the last time that we went to Margaritaville. This casino was closed you know. The newest casino in Biloxi but, the first one to go. Jimmy Buffet/Margaritaville did not come to an agreement with their landlords. They are supposed to build a hotel come 2015, it's needed so they can stay in business. They can't compete with other casinos in the area if they don't have a hotel. They were closed at 10 PM on a Monday, September 15, 2014. Only 2 years since they opened in 2012.

On this particular day, we dine in one of their restaurants overlooking the Biloxi Bay. It was gorgeous. As we head home, we saw the parking lot empty and was a bit sad. 

When I saw the beautiful sky, I said a prayer that the workers in this company will find a new job easy.

Small Sharks Caught

Here in Florida, the shark population is totally diverse. Shark species range in sizes from few feet to more than 40 feet in total length according to a study. All sea-goers are being warned about this fact. Sea-goers should beware of sharks 6 feet or longer because the damage they can cause in a single bite is really dangerous.

Among the species that grow big and have been known to attack humans are bull sharks, tiger sharks and great white sharks. Unfortunately, that is the reason that I am chicken to go swimming on the beach. According to the experts, these type of sharks are not predominant so; beach-goers or sea-goers are unlikely to come across these sharks in Florida waters.

Anyway, I am not an expert with sharks so; I do not know what species these were. I forgot to ask the man in-charge. I heard him say that these sharks will never grow more than what they are. Meaning, these are not baby sharks and these are fully grown sharks in their species. Most of the passengers/guests were requesting them to fillet the sharks. Yes, these can be eaten.

The Final Ride of the Discovery Space Shuttle

Hubby and I woke up at 6AM and started the day early. We wanted to see the world's greatest piggyback ride of the space shuttle Discovery. We stayed on the boat ramp on our main street along US 1 just across the Kennedy Space Center area. For the naked eye, the sight of the orbiter back riding the Shuttle Carrier Aircraft is really amazing.Just click on the pictures to zoom in.The view of the Indian River is truly wonderful this morning. The sunshine was hidden by the thick clouds. The weather was nice and cool but, it never change a thing.....the Discovery has retired.In this area, we are less than a hundred but, the whole parking lot was occupied. Besides, not too many people come to Kennedy Space Center to witness this big event.When the Boeing 747 left the Kennedy Space Center, it fly over Cocoa area and came back to KSC for one last time. It was flying so low and it was a surreal experience. Anyway, NASA has offered Discovery to the Smithsonian Institution's National Air and Space Museum for public display and also preservation. Discovery will replace Enterprise in the Smithsonian's display at the Steven F. Udvar-Hazy Center in Virginia. Discovery was transported to Dulles International Airport today, and will be transferred to the Udvar-Hazy on April 19 where a formal welcome ceremony is planned.

Chester M. McPhearson, Jr. Pier in Ocean Springs Mississippi

Hello Travel Tuesday hoppers. Thanks for the comments last week, I enjoyed reading them. Today, I would like to show you the view of the Gulf Coast. I took these photos while we were at Chester M. McPhearson, Jr. Pier in Ocean Springs Mississippi. According to my husband, he was the mayor in this city at one time and year's ago, he own a hardware store in the middle of the town.
That's me feeding the birds at sunset. Hubby and I love going on the beach which is just 5 minutes or less from the house.

There are so many birds here and people would come by to feed them. Birds and animals are protected so; no one is allowed to hurt them and definitely, no hunting in this area.

This beach is open for public and it is Free.

This is located in Beach Boulevard in the city of Ocean Springs right off the Highway 90. Oh, the beach is few miles long so; if you drive down the Gulf Coast, you would see this amazing view too.

We came here at the Pier to go fishing and crabbing. Sometimes, we move to the harbor.

That's hubby looking on the Bay of Biloxi and that building is the Isle Hotel.

There was a damage on this Pier during Hurricane Katrina so; they build them back that is why, it looks so new.

We pass by here every morning too right after I logged out from work. I work in the casino at night (graveyard shift) and by 7 am we pass here on our way home. A good area to see the sunset, sunrise and just have a picnic.
